Garner and Cardinal Gibbons squared off in some playoff action on Friday, but Garner had to settle for second. They had to suffer through a 51-14 loss at the hands of the Cardinal Gibbons Crusaders. The Trojans were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 44-7.
Although Garner took the loss, they still got scores from JC Covington and Aidan Gore.
Gannon Jones continued his habit of posting crazy stat lines for Cardinal Gibbons, rushing for 90 yards and two touchdowns, while also throwing for 259 yards and three touchdowns. Those 90 rushing yards gave Jones a new career-high. Brayden Karras was Jones' top target, picking up 89 receiving yards and two touchdowns.
Garner's loss dropped their record down to 8-4. As for Cardinal Gibbons, they pushed their record up to 10-1 with the win, which was their fifth straight at home.
Garner does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Cardinal Gibbons, they will look to defend their home field on Friday against Hillside at 7:00 p.m. Cardinal Gibbons is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 37.7 points per game this season.
